README.md
pyproject.toml
src/klaude_code.egg-info/PKG-INFO
src/klaude_code.egg-info/SOURCES.txt
src/klaude_code.egg-info/dependency_links.txt
src/klaude_code.egg-info/entry_points.txt
src/klaude_code.egg-info/requires.txt
src/klaude_code.egg-info/top_level.txt
src/klaudecode/__init__.py
src/klaudecode/agent/__init__.py
src/klaudecode/agent/agent.py
src/klaudecode/agent/executor.py
src/klaudecode/agent/state.py
src/klaudecode/agent/subagent.py
src/klaudecode/cli/__init__.py
src/klaudecode/cli/config.py
src/klaudecode/cli/edit.py
src/klaudecode/cli/main.py
src/klaudecode/cli/mcp.py
src/klaudecode/cli/updater.py
src/klaudecode/cli/version.py
src/klaudecode/config/__init__.py
src/klaudecode/config/arg_source.py
src/klaudecode/config/default_source.py
src/klaudecode/config/env_source.py
src/klaudecode/config/file_config_source.py
src/klaudecode/config/manager.py
src/klaudecode/config/model.py
src/klaudecode/config/source.py
src/klaudecode/llm/__init__.py
src/klaudecode/llm/llm_client.py
src/klaudecode/llm/llm_manager.py
src/klaudecode/llm/llm_proxy_anthropic.py
src/klaudecode/llm/llm_proxy_base.py
src/klaudecode/llm/llm_proxy_gemini.py
src/klaudecode/llm/llm_proxy_openai.py
src/klaudecode/mcp/__init__.py
src/klaudecode/mcp/mcp_client.py
src/klaudecode/mcp/mcp_config.py
src/klaudecode/mcp/mcp_tool.py
src/klaudecode/message/__init__.py
src/klaudecode/message/assistant.py
src/klaudecode/message/base.py
src/klaudecode/message/registry.py
src/klaudecode/message/system.py
src/klaudecode/message/tool_call.py
src/klaudecode/message/tool_result.py
src/klaudecode/message/user.py
src/klaudecode/prompt/commands.py
src/klaudecode/prompt/plan_mode.py
src/klaudecode/prompt/reminder.py
src/klaudecode/prompt/system.py
src/klaudecode/prompt/tools.py
src/klaudecode/session/__init__.py
src/klaudecode/session/message_history.py
src/klaudecode/session/session.py
src/klaudecode/session/session_operations.py
src/klaudecode/session/session_storage.py
src/klaudecode/tool/__init__.py
src/klaudecode/tool/base.py
src/klaudecode/tool/display.py
src/klaudecode/tool/executor.py
src/klaudecode/tool/handler.py
src/klaudecode/tool/instance.py
src/klaudecode/tool/schema.py
src/klaudecode/tools/__init__.py
src/klaudecode/tools/__main__.py
src/klaudecode/tools/bash.py
src/klaudecode/tools/command_pattern_result.py
src/klaudecode/tools/edit.py
src/klaudecode/tools/exit_plan_mode.py
src/klaudecode/tools/glob.py
src/klaudecode/tools/grep.py
src/klaudecode/tools/ls.py
src/klaudecode/tools/multi_edit.py
src/klaudecode/tools/read.py
src/klaudecode/tools/task.py
src/klaudecode/tools/todo.py
src/klaudecode/tools/undo_edit.py
src/klaudecode/tools/write.py
src/klaudecode/tui/__init__.py
src/klaudecode/tui/colors.py
src/klaudecode/tui/console.py
src/klaudecode/tui/diff_renderer.py
src/klaudecode/tui/logo.py
src/klaudecode/tui/markdown_renderer.py
src/klaudecode/tui/renderers.py
src/klaudecode/tui/status.py
src/klaudecode/tui/stream_status.py
src/klaudecode/tui/theme_preview.py
src/klaudecode/tui/utils.py
src/klaudecode/user_command/__init__.py
src/klaudecode/user_command/command_clear.py
src/klaudecode/user_command/command_compact.py
src/klaudecode/user_command/command_continue.py
src/klaudecode/user_command/command_cost.py
src/klaudecode/user_command/command_debug.py
src/klaudecode/user_command/command_example_custom_command.py
src/klaudecode/user_command/command_init.py
src/klaudecode/user_command/command_mac_setup.py
src/klaudecode/user_command/command_mcp.py
src/klaudecode/user_command/command_memory.py
src/klaudecode/user_command/command_output.py
src/klaudecode/user_command/command_save_custom_command.py
src/klaudecode/user_command/command_status.py
src/klaudecode/user_command/command_theme.py
src/klaudecode/user_command/custom_command.py
src/klaudecode/user_command/custom_command_manager.py
src/klaudecode/user_command/input_mode_bash.py
src/klaudecode/user_command/input_mode_memory.py
src/klaudecode/user_command/input_mode_plan.py
src/klaudecode/user_command/query_rewrite_command.py
src/klaudecode/user_input/__init__.py
src/klaudecode/user_input/input_command.py
src/klaudecode/user_input/input_completer.py
src/klaudecode/user_input/input_handler.py
src/klaudecode/user_input/input_mode.py
src/klaudecode/user_input/input_select.py
src/klaudecode/user_input/input_session.py
src/klaudecode/utils/exception.py
src/klaudecode/utils/image_utils.py
src/klaudecode/utils/str_utils.py
src/klaudecode/utils/bash_utils/__init__.py
src/klaudecode/utils/bash_utils/command_execution.py
src/klaudecode/utils/bash_utils/environment.py
src/klaudecode/utils/bash_utils/interaction_detection.py
src/klaudecode/utils/bash_utils/output_processing.py
src/klaudecode/utils/bash_utils/process_management.py
src/klaudecode/utils/bash_utils/security.py
src/klaudecode/utils/file_utils/__init__.py
src/klaudecode/utils/file_utils/diff_utils.py
src/klaudecode/utils/file_utils/directory_constants.py
src/klaudecode/utils/file_utils/directory_tree_builder.py
src/klaudecode/utils/file_utils/directory_utils.py
src/klaudecode/utils/file_utils/file_backup.py
src/klaudecode/utils/file_utils/file_glob.py
src/klaudecode/utils/file_utils/file_readers.py
src/klaudecode/utils/file_utils/file_tracker.py
src/klaudecode/utils/file_utils/file_validation.py
src/klaudecode/utils/file_utils/file_writers.py
src/klaudecode/utils/file_utils/gitignore_parser.py
src/klaudecode/utils/file_utils/path_utils.py
src/klaudecode/utils/file_utils/string_operations.py